    Thinkpad T60 (2007-6QU)
    14.1” SXGA+ Core 2 Duo T7400 2.16GHz processor,120GB 5400rpm Hard Drive, 1GB RAM, multi-burner, ATI Mobility Radeon X1400 128MB PCIe, Fingerprint Reader, Bluetooth, GB Ethernet, 802.11 a/b/g, XP PRO, 9 Cell Battery, 3yr Warranty.
    UCSD Price $1,599.00 (list $2,035.00)

    15" MacBook Pro
    15.4” 2.16GHz Intel Core 2 Duo, 4MB L2 Cache, 1GB DDR2 PC-5300 (2 Dimms) 120GB SATA HDD (5400 RPM), 256MB ATI Radeon x1600, SuperDrive 6x Dual Layer iSight, Apple Remote, Airport Extreme, Bluetooth 2.0, FireWire 400 and 800.


    It's a sale available at my school's bookstore. Do you guys think it's a good deal for a T60? They're also having a sale on Macbook Pros for $1700. What do you think is a better buy? I'm a computer arts major and usually use 3ds max, blender, flash, photoshop, and illustrator.
